Low Penetration Level Makes Middle East Insurance a Lucrative Sector

With the total insurance penetration below 10% of insurable population in the Middle East, it is expected that the region will witness rapid growth in near future. As per our research report Middle East Insurance Market Forecast to 2012”, takaful will play a major role in the Middle East insurance sector. In the past, it has grown at a rate of 135% in the UAE, followed by 69% in Bahrain. Young educated population and government initiatives will fuel growth in the insurance sector of the region.
 
The report gives comprehensive information and an in-depth analysis of the insurance industry of various countries present in the Middle East. These countries include Kuwait, Bahrain, Saudi Arabia, Qatar, United Arab Emirates, Oman, Turkey, Iran, Israel and Jordan. The report gives details about the market size of these countries and states that Israel was the largest market in the region for insurance premium, followed by Turkey and UAE.
